Oracle数据库视频教学教程

需积分: 5 2 下载量 134 浏览量 更新于2024-10-18 收藏 237B ZIP 举报
资源摘要信息: "Oracle视频教学视频" 知识点一:Oracle数据库基础 Oracle数据库是由甲骨文公司(Oracle Corporation)研发的一款关系型数据库管理系统(RDBMS)。Oracle数据库采用了优化的SQL,同时还包含了全套的应用开发工具。作为最流行的企业级数据库之一,Oracle提供了强大的数据处理能力,广泛应用于金融、通信、交通、制造等行业。基础知识点涉及数据库的安装、配置、管理、数据操作语言(DML)、数据定义语言(DDL)、数据控制语言(DCL)和事务控制语言(TCL)等方面。 知识点二:Oracle数据库架构 在Oracle视频教学中,会介绍Oracle数据库的体系结构,包括物理结构和逻辑结构。物理结构主要涉及到数据文件、控制文件、重做日志文件等文件的管理与维护。逻辑结构则涉及到表空间、段、区、数据块等概念。这些内容是数据库管理员进行数据库设计、优化和故障排除的重要理论基础。 知识点三:PL/SQL编程基础 PL/SQL是Oracle数据库的专属编程语言,它是一种过程化语言,结合了SQL的语言特性和传统编程语言的流程控制和复合数据结构。在Oracle视频教学视频中,会介绍PL/SQL的基本语法、程序结构(如匿名块、过程、函数、触发器等),以及如何使用PL/SQL进行高效的数据库编程,包括错误处理和程序调试技巧。 知识点四:Oracle数据库性能优化 视频教学可能还会涵盖Oracle数据库的性能优化方面的知识,比如如何分析执行计划、使用Oracle提供的各种分析工具(如AWR报告、ASH报告等),以及SQL调优的技巧等。对于数据库管理员而言,优化数据库性能是提高系统运行效率、确保业务连续性的关键。 知识点五:数据备份与恢复 数据备份与恢复是数据库管理中非常关键的一环。视频教学可能会介绍Oracle提供的不同备份与恢复策略,包括RMAN(Recovery Manager)的使用方法,以及逻辑备份(导出/导入)等技术。这些操作保证了在数据丢失或系统故障时,可以迅速恢复数据,减少损失。 知识点六:安全管理 在Oracle视频教学中,安全管理也是一个重要话题。教学内容可能会包括用户权限管理、角色的创建与分配、审计功能的使用等,确保数据库的安全性。管理员需要掌握如何有效地分配资源访问权限,防止未授权访问,以及监控和记录数据库活动。 知识点七:Oracle最新技术动态 由于Oracle数据库不断更新,视频教学内容也可能会涉及Oracle的最新技术动态,比如云计算服务、大数据分析、机器学习集成等,这些内容帮助数据库管理员和开发者了解Oracle技术的发展趋势,以及如何利用这些新技术提升业务价值。 知识点八:实践案例分析 视频教学中往往会包含实际案例分析,通过对真实或模拟案例的讲解,帮助学习者理解如何将理论知识应用到实际工作中,提高解决实际问题的能力。案例分析可能包括常见的数据库故障排查、性能调优案例、安全加固案例等。 总结以上知识点,Oracle视频教学视频是面向数据库管理员和开发者的专业教学资源。其内容涵盖Oracle数据库的基础知识、架构、PL/SQL编程、性能优化、备份与恢复、安全管理、新技术动态以及实践案例分析等多方面,旨在为学习者提供全面、深入的Oracle数据库技能训练,帮助他们成为合格的数据库专业人员。